Different jobs call for different gravel sizes. The table below lists the crushed gravel options you can order by the ton. Each size compacts to a stable surface, so you can pick the one that fits your project.
| Product | Best For | Note |
|---|---|---|
| 3/8" Crushed Gravel | Fine compacting layer | Gives a smooth, tight surface for walking areas and final topping. |
| 3/4" Crushed Gravel | The workhorse size for base and drives | Handles vehicle loads and compacts well for stable driveways. |
| 1" - 1 1/2" Crushed Gravel | Structural base under heavy loads | Provides good drainage and support on weaker ground. |
| 1 1/2" Crushed Gravel | First lift over soft subgrade | A coarse layer that bridges soft spots and stabilizes the base. |
| 2"-3" Crushed Gravel | Mud control and deep fill | Fills ruts and creates a stable foundation on wet, soft ground. |
Match the material to the problem you are fixing. The table below pairs typical project conditions with the right crushed gravel from the list above.
| Project | What to Order | Depth or Note |
|---|---|---|
| Soft or muddy subgrade | 1 1/2" Crushed Gravel | First lift to bridge and stabilize soft ground. |
| Compacted base | 3/4" Crushed Gravel | Workhorse base for most driveways and pads. |
| Farm and site access road | 2"-3" Crushed Gravel | Handles heavy equipment and resists mud. |
| Shed or slab pad | 3/8" Crushed Gravel | Fine layer for a smooth, compacted surface under a structure. |
| Trench backfill | 1" - 1 1/2" Crushed Gravel | Angular gravel locks together for stable backfill. |
Tower gets about 28 inches of precipitation a year. That means drainage and washout planning matter for any gravel surface. The ground here is in hydrologic group C, which takes water in slowly and sheds a fair amount across the surface. A deeper drainage layer earns its place under your crushed gravel.
About 203 days a year drop below 32 degrees F. The long freeze-thaw cycle means the ground moves as it thaws. Ground that freezes deep moves as it thaws, which is why the base layer matters more here than the top layer. About 69 inches of snow falls annually, so plowing can damage a loose surface. A well-compacted crushed gravel base resists gouging.

Yes. The soil in the Tower area is in hydrologic group C, which means it takes water in slowly. To compensate, a deeper drainage layer of coarse crushed gravel helps shed water away from the base. This can increase the total amount you need compared to a site with sandy soil.
Late spring through early fall is the most reliable time. About 203 days a year drop below freezing, and deep frost can make the ground too soft or frozen for a stable base. Ordering when the ground is thawed and dry gives the best compaction results.
The depth depends on the load and the subgrade. A driveway usually needs 6 to 8 inches of compacted crushed gravel, while a shed pad may only need 3 to 4 inches. Use our material calculators to estimate the tonnage based on your depth.
